Brick Hardscaping in Boston, MA
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and repair of durable features made from brick materials to enhance outdoor spaces. Common projects include patios, walkways, garden borders, retaining walls, and stairs, providing both functional and aesthetic improvements to residential properties. Homeowners typically want to understand the variety of brick patterns and styles available, the durability of different brick types, and the scope of work involved in creating a long-lasting outdoor feature. It’s also helpful to consider how brick hardscaping can complement existing landscape elements and improve property value.
Before requesting brick hardscaping services, property owners should clarify their project goals, preferred design styles, and any specific requirements for durability or maintenance. Knowing the approximate size and location of the project helps in planning the scope and materials needed. Understanding the importance of proper foundation preparation and drainage considerations can also influence the longevity of the finished feature. Asking about available brick options, installation techniques, and maintenance requirements can ensure the project aligns with overall property plans and expectations.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ick patios - durable and attractive surfaces for outdoor living areas.
Brick walkways - functional paths that enhance curb appeal and accessibility.
Brick retaining walls - help manage slopes and define landscape levels.
Brick fire pits - create inviting focal points for outdoor gatherings.
Brick steps and staircases - provide safe and stylish access to different property areas.
Brick edging and borders - define garden beds and landscape features with clean lines.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are common for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is often used for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ders in residential properties.
How durable is brick for outdoor hardscaping? Brick is a durable material that withstands weather conditions and regular use, making it suitable for outdoor applications.
What should property owners consider before installing brick hardscaping? It's important to assess drainage, foundation stability, and design compatibility with existing landscape features.
Can brick hardscaping be integrated with other landscaping elements? Yes, brick features can complement various landscape elements like plantings, lighting, and water features for a cohesive look.
